Comprehending the Goethe-Zertifikat
Administered by the Goethe-Institut-- the cultural institute of the Federal Republic of Germany-- these exams assess efficiency across all 4 language skills: reading, listening, composing, and speaking.
The accreditations are divided into six levels, varying from outright novice to near-native fluency:
- A1/ A2: Basic language use
- B1/ b2 deutsch zertifikat kaufen: Independent language usage
- C1/ C2: Proficient language usage
Why is the Goethe-Zertifikat Important?
- University Admissions: Most German-language universities need a minimum of a B2 or C1 certificate for registration.
- Visa and Immigration: Authorities in Germany, Austria, and Switzerland often mandate evidence of language skills for family reunification or work visas.
- Career Mobility: Multinational corporations value the accreditation as concrete proof of interaction abilities.

Securing your credential efficiently needs understanding the main flexibilities provided by the Goethe-Institut, together with additional digital preparation tools.
1. Modular Exams
One of the most substantial advancements in test flexibility is the modular format available for numerous levels (such as b1 zertifikat online kaufen, B2, and C1). Instead of sitting for all four skills on a single tiring day, candidates can:
- Take individual modules individually (e.g., Reading and Listening on one day, Writing and Speaking on another).
- Retake just the specific module they did not pass, saving both money and time.
2. Digital Goethe-Zertifikat
The goethe c2-Institut has progressively presented digital versions of its tests. The Digital Goethe-Zertifikat allows prospects to take the reading, listening, and composing areas on a computer system at qualified test centers, typically resulting in:
- Faster turnaround times for outcomes.
- More regular screening dates compared to standard paper-based tests.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Can I take the Goethe-Zertifikat entirely online from home?
No. For security and standardization functions, official Goethe-Zertifikat exams must be taken at a licensed Goethe-Institut or an official partner test center, either on paper or via safe and secure digital workstations.
2. What does it indicate to take the examination in "modules"?
Taking the test in modules indicates you can split the four parts of the examination (Reading, Listening, Writing, Speaking) and take them on different days or perhaps retake just the particular module you stopped working, depending on the guidelines of the particular test level.
3. How long are Goethe-Zertifikate valid?
Unlike some other language tests that end after two years, the Goethe-Zertifikat does not have a main expiration date. Nevertheless, numerous organizations and employers prefer certificates gotten within the last 2 to 3 years to ensure current proficiency.
